Services Offered

When you're dealing with the loss of a loved one, knowing what services are available can be a huge help. Walter E. Baird Funeral Home typically offers a wide range of options to meet different needs and preferences. First off, there's the traditional funeral service. This usually involves a viewing or visitation, where family and friends can pay their respects to the deceased. This is followed by a formal funeral ceremony, often held in a church or the funeral home chapel. The ceremony might include eulogies, readings, music, and prayers. After the ceremony, the body is typically transported to a cemetery for burial. Cremation is another common option. In this case, the body is cremated, and the ashes can be scattered, kept in an urn, or placed in a columbarium. Funeral homes can arrange for cremation services and help families decide what to do with the ashes. Memorial services are similar to funeral services, but the body is not present. These services can be held at any time and place, allowing for greater flexibility. They might involve sharing memories, displaying photos, and celebrating the life of the deceased in a unique and personal way. Beyond these core services, Walter E. Baird Funeral Home often provides additional support, such as grief counseling, pre-planning services, and assistance with paperwork. Grief counseling can help individuals cope with their loss and navigate the grieving process. Pre-planning allows individuals to make arrangements for their own funeral in advance, relieving their families of the burden during a difficult time. Assistance with paperwork can include obtaining death certificates, filing insurance claims, and notifying government agencies. The goal is to provide comprehensive support to families, taking care of all the details so they can focus on healing and remembering. Each service is handled with utmost care and respect, ensuring that the deceased is honored in a dignified manner and that the family's wishes are met.

Another big benefit of pre-planning is that it can help you save money. Funeral costs can be significant, and they often catch families off guard. By pre-planning, you can lock in prices and avoid future inflation. You can also explore different payment options and make arrangements that fit your budget. This can provide peace of mind knowing that your funeral expenses are taken care of.
